Abstract
This invention relates to input channel diagnostics for an industrial process control system. The invention provides improved apparatus and methods relating to fault containment, overload protection and input channel diagnostics.

10. A method of internally testing an input channel for a safety critical system, the method comprising:
-
adding a perturbation signal to an input signal to be applied to an input circuit; detecting an output signal from the input circuit; determining whether addition of said perturbation signal causes a change in said output signal; passing the input signal from an input circuit that includes one or more series resistors that have a total resistance that is at least two orders of magnitude greater than the resistance of a conditioned sensor signal source; and passing the input signal through a fuse that is oriented in series with the one or more series resistors and has an operating threshold that is lower than an operating threshold of the one or more series resistors. - View Dependent Claims (11)
